Q1: A wooden plank (sp. gr. 0.5) 1 m x 1 m x 0.5 m floats in water with 1.5 kN load on it with 1 m x 1 m surface horizontal. The depth of plank lying below water surface shall be

A 0.178 m

B 0.250 m

C 0.403 m

D 0.500 m

ANS:C - 0.403 m

The wt of plank + wt of load = wt of fluid displaced.
(since wkt, wt = sp weight x Vol) (sp wt= density x g).

density x g x 1 x 1 x 0.5 + 1.5 x 1000 = 1000 x 9.81 x 1 x 1 x h.
( h= height of plank below the water level).

(1000 x 0.5 (sp gravity)) x 9.81 x 1 x 1 x 0.5 + 1.5 x 1000 = 1000 x 9.81 x 1 x 1 x h.
( since wkt, sp gravity = density of material / density of water).

Answer h=0.403.
